The Northwestern Bulls's homestand will continue as they prepare to take on the Lely Trojans at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. Keep an eye on the score for this one: both posted some lofty point totals in their previous games.

Northwestern is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Friday. They took their contest with ease, bagging a 69-0 win over Barron Collier. Considering the Bulls have won six matchups by more than 34 points this season, Friday's blowout was nothing new.

Leon Strawder was his usual excellent self, throwing for 156 yards and four touchdowns on only ten passes. King Davis helped Strawder out on the ground, rushing for 68 yards and a touchdown.

Meanwhile, Lely had already won three in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 29 points) and they went ahead and made it four on Friday. They snuck past the Generals with a 44-39 victory.

Lely's success was spearheaded by the efforts of Ty Collins, who rushed for 301 yards while picking up 8.4 yards per carry, and Carter Quinn, who threw for 165 yards and three touchdowns. With that strong performance, Collins is now averaging an impressive 114.2 rushing yards per game.

Lely was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 301 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 217 rushing yards in three consecutive matches.

Lely pushed their record up to 7-4 with the win, which was their seventh straight at home dating back to last season. Those good results were due in large part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 54.6 points per game. As for Northwestern, their victory bumped their record up to 8-2.
